The global Bioinformatics Services Market is rapidly expanding, driven by advances in biology, IT, and computation that support the analysis and management of large-scale biological data. Valued around USD 4.6 billion in 2025, the market is projected to reach approximately USD 12.4 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of about 13.5%. The growth is fueled by the rising demand for personalized medicine, next-generation sequencing adoption, AI/ML integration, and increasing outsourcing trends from pharmaceutical, biotechnology, and healthcare sectors.
Bioinformatics services sit at the intersection of biology, IT, and computer science, supporting the analysis, interpretation, and management of large-scale biological data. As genomic, proteomic, and metabolomic research generates massive datasets, these services become essential across sectors such as p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, healthcare, agriculture, and academia. Core offerings include data analysis, sequencing, software development, and data management.
Growth is further fueled by the rising adoption of next-generation sequencing (NGS), personalized medicine, and cloud-based platforms powered by AI and machine learning. The increasing trend of outsourcing bioinformatics services also enables access to specialized expertise without significant in-house investment.

Market Overview
Bioinformatics services are pivotal in interpreting complex biological information generated from genomics, proteomics, transcriptomics, and metabolomics research. These services offer data analysis, sequencing, software and tool development, data management, consulting, and outsourcing to support research and clinical applications. The rise of personalized medicine, propelled by genomic data and molecular profiling, increases the demand for precise analysis and tailored therapies. High-throughput technologies like next-generation sequencing drastically increase biological data volumes, necessitating robust bioinformatics solutions. The integration of AI and machine learning accelerates data processing and predictive analyses, further expanding market potential.

Rising Demand for Personalized Medicine is anticipated to lift the Bioinformatics Services Market during the forecast period
Rising interest in personalized medicine drives the market for bioinformatics services. Personalized medicine depends largely on genomic, genetic, and molecular information for tailoring treatment regimes for individual patients. Bioinformatics services support the analysis and interpretation of complex biological information such that healthcare professionals are able to deliver therapies more precisely. As next-generation sequencing (NGS) and genome-wide association studies (GWAS) gain wider usage, the volume of data produced is rising exponentially, which needs to be processed and interpreted by advanced bioinformatics tools.
Pharmaceutical firms are making significant investments in precision medicine initiatives, involving large-scale bioinformatics support for target identification, drug response analysis, and biomarker finding. The trend is most prominent within the area of oncology, where individualized treatment methods are yielding dramatic clinical achievements. With personalized medicine already a common fixture of healthcare delivery, the need for advanced-level bioinformatics services will keep growing, fueling market expansion.
The convergence of machine learning (ML) and artificial intelligence (AI) into the realm of bioinformatics means big opportunities for market growth. AI and ML can handle vast datasets at previously unimaginable speeds, revealing patterns, forecasts, and insights that conventionally might go unnoticed. In the domains of proteomics, genomics, and drug development, AI-powered bioinformatics tools have the capacity to drastically reduce the time between data collection and decisions.
AI-based algorithms are currently utilized for tasks like variant calling within genomics, protein structure prediction, and predicting clinical outcomes from genomic information. As these technologies improve, service providers of bioinformatics that adopt AI/ML as part of their suite of offerings can provide increasingly more advanced, efficient, and effective solutions. In addition, the coming of predictive analytics for healthcare and the drive towards accelerated, target-oriented drug development are generating more interest in AI-enhanced bioinformatics services. The early adopters of AI/ML integration by companies are likely to have a differentiation advantage; thus, this represents a very promising area of growth.
Market Segments
The market is segmented by:
- Service Types: Data management services hold the largest share due to the vast volume of complex biological data requiring secure and efficient storage, retrieval, and processing. Other segments include data analysis, sequencing, software/tool development, consulting, and outsourcing services.
- Applications: Genomics dominates, driven by genome sequencing, personalized medicine, and genetic research. Other key applications include proteomics, transcriptomics, pharmacogenomics, and clinical diagnostics.
- End-Users: P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ies represent the fastest-growing segment due to their increasing investment in drug discovery, precision medicine, and biomarker research. Academic and research institutes, hospitals, healthcare institutions, and contract research organizations also contribute significantly.
- Regions: North America leads the market owing to its strong presence of biotech/pharma companies and R&D infrastructure. Asia Pacific, with countries like China, India, Japan, and South Korea, is the fastest-growing region due to increasing healthcare investment, genomic research, and favorable cost structures.
- Global Bioinformatics Services Market Recent Developments News:
- Agilent acquired Canadian CDMO BioVectra in September 2024 for US$925 million, expanding its capabilities in sterile fill-finish, pDNA, mRNA, LNP formulation, and advanced therapeutics like ADCs, HPAPIs, GLP-1s, and gene editing.
- In April 2024, SOPHiA GENETICS partnered with Strand Life Sciences to deliver end-to-end genomic analysis solutions, combining genomics, diagnostics, and bioinformatics to advance precision medicine.
- Recursion Pharmaceuticals acquired Exscientia in August 2024 for $688 million, merging AI-driven drug design with high-throughput screening to create an integrated drug discovery platform.
